According to the Saudi Ministry of Education, the summer vacation for schools will commence immediately after the conclusion of the third academic semester. The last school day is expected to be on Thursday, 1 Dhu al-Hijjah 1446, corresponding to June 27, 2025. Consequently, students will have an important recreational opportunity that allows them to enjoy a period of rest, travel, and engage in hobbies before returning to their studies.
The start date of the vacation is set for June 27, 2025, with the end of the third academic semester occurring in the first week of Dhu al-Hijjah 1446. This summer vacation 1446 provides a chance to renew both physical and mental activity, helping students return with a refreshed spirit for the new academic year.
In contrast, the summer vacation for Saudi universities in 1446 differs from that of schools, as it depends on the date of the end of the second academic semester. University vacations are anticipated to begin after mid-Dhu al-Qadah 1446. This timing offers students opportunities for summer training or volunteer projects, allowing them to enhance their skills and participate in activities that prepare them for the job market.
The duration of the summer vacation in Saudi Arabia for 1446 will extend until Sunday, 14 Safar 1447, which corresponds to August 17, 2025, lasting approximately 51 days. This period is shorter than the usual vacations in previous years due to the implementation of a three-semester system. The summer vacation for schools will thus span from 1 Dhu al-Hijjah 1446, or June 27, 2025, until 14 Safar 1447, or August 17, 2025, providing students with a well-deserved break before the start of the new academic year.
The three-semester system has contributed to distributing vacations throughout the year, directly impacting the length of the summer vacation. However, students benefit from shorter recreational periods between semesters, which alleviates the pressure of continuous study. Therefore, accurately determining the date of the summer vacation 1446 helps families plan their summer holidays effectively.
Meanwhile, in Morocco, the Ministry of National Education, Primary Education, and Sports has officially announced the date of the 2025 spring vacation, generating excitement among students across various educational levels. This vacation serves as a perfect opportunity to relieve academic pressures and rejuvenate energy. It also allows families to enjoy quality time together, whether through planning fun activities or embarking on relaxing trips.
The 2025 spring vacation will encompass all educational institutions, from primary schools to universities, as confirmed by the ministry. The goal is to balance educational processes between study and relaxation, ensuring students have adequate time to recharge. The official dates for this vacation are as follows: it begins on Sunday, March 30, 2025, and ends on Sunday, April 13, 2025. Studies will resume on Monday, April 14, 2025.

In another significant development, Egypt is preparing to implement summer time in 2025, with the change officially set to take effect at midnight on Friday, April 25, 2025, the last Friday of the month. This decision, based on Law No. 24 of 2023, aims to enhance energy efficiency by advancing the clock by 60 minutes. This change is particularly pertinent given the rising electricity consumption during the spring and summer seasons.
The government strategically chose Friday for this time change since it is a public holiday for most sectors, providing citizens ample opportunity to adjust to the new schedule without disrupting daily life. However, citizens should note that this change will also affect official prayer times, particularly for Fajr, Maghrib, and Isha, necessitating adjustments to align with the new time.
To assist citizens in adjusting their devices, specific steps have been outlined for changing the time on Android and iPhone smartphones. For Android users, they should navigate to Settings, select "Additional Settings," go to "Date and Time," activate the "Automatic Time Zone" option, and restart their devices. iPhone users can similarly access Settings, choose "General," click on "Date & Time," and enable "Set Automatically."
It is noteworthy that summer time was abolished in Egypt in 2018, but the government reinstated it in 2023 as part of a comprehensive plan to address global economic challenges, focusing on reducing electricity consumption and maximizing daylight utilization.
